Abstract
A system for providing remote monitoring of electricity consumption is provided. Briefly described, in one embodiment the system may comprise a plurality of electric meters, a plurality of communication devices having a unique address and defining a wireless communication network, and a site controller. Each of the plurality of electric meters may be configured to measure the electricity consumption of a load attached to the electric meter. Each of the plurality of communication devices may be associated with one of the plurality of electric meters and configured to receive data related to the electricity consumption of the electric meter data and generate a transmit message using a predefined communication protocol being implemented by the wireless communication network. The transmit message may comprise the unique identifier and the data related to the electricity consumption of the electric meter. The site controller may be configured for communication with the wireless communication network and configured to receive the transmit message from one of the plurality of communication devices, identify the electric meter associated with the transmit message, and provide information related to the transmit message to a wide area network for delivery to a host computer.

17. A site controller adapted for use in an automated monitoring system for providing remote monitoring of commodity consumption, the automated monitoring system comprising a site controller in communication with a plurality of communication devices coupled to commodity meters via a wireless communication network and in communication with a host computer via a wide area network, the site controller comprising:
-
a processor configured to execute instructions;
memory comprising instructions executable by the processor related to remote monitoring of commodity consumption;
a wireless transceiver configured for communication over the wireless communication network and configured to receive one or more transmit messages repeated by one or more communication devices prior to receipt by the site controller, wherein the one or more transmit messages include commodity consumption measured by a commodity meter and a unique identifier corresponding to the communication device that originated the transmit message; and
logic contained in memory and executable by the processor to generate outbound messages to one or more recipient communication devices such that the route of communication includes one or more communication devices that repeat the outbound message to the recipient communication device. - View Dependent Claims (18, 19, 20, 21, 22)
